Marigold Naughty Marietta 30-35cm
French Marigold Naughty Marietta. Really large, single blooms of deep golden-yellow with a large maroon blotch. An outstanding bedding strain.

Marigold Triploid

Marigold F1 Triploid giving you a selection of single or double flowers on continuously blooming plants. Cross between French and African they are infertile and do not set viable seed, therefore free flowering and vigorous under extremes of weather. Impressive displays in borders, patio tubs and planters, the first flower is not always typical of the variety.
